Re: Custom Camper, Camper Special and The Longhorn

The Sierra Grande was a trim package. It could be had on any bed length truck. The 133” trucks were available in fleet side “Longhorn” or step side configuration as well as cab and chassis with no bed at all.

Re: Custom Camper, Camper Special and The Longhorn

GMC didn't put any badging on their 133" wheelbase trucks with fleetside beds (i.e. with 8' 6" bed). It was just a 133" wheelbase truck.
Longhorn script on the bed was for Chevs only.
133" wheelbase was unrelated to the separate RPO Z81 Custom Camper option, but Z81 could be ordered on a 133" wheelbase truck (and often was).
"Custom Camper" was the RPO Z81 option that resulted in the Custom Camper script above the door handle from 68-72 for GMC. As has been noted above, in 67 it was the Camper Cruiser, a pretty rare truck.
Camper Special was not an option until 73 (even though different terminology exists across some of the SPIDs in this era - the actual Z81 RPO was "Custom Camper")
